A Heart's Triumph Over Betrayal

La Arrolladora Banda El Limón's song "No Regresaré" is a powerful narrative of emotional resilience and self-respect. The lyrics recount a past relationship where the protagonist was dismissed and undervalued by their partner. The partner once claimed that forgetting the protagonist would be easy and that the love felt by the protagonist was merely a source of amusement. This dismissive attitude is a clear indication of the partner's lack of genuine affection and respect.

As the song progresses, the tables turn. The partner, who once thought they could easily move on, finds themselves returning, seeking forgiveness and perhaps reconciliation. However, the protagonist, having endured the pain and grown stronger, refuses to go back to the toxic relationship. The repeated phrase "No regresaré" (I will not return) underscores the protagonist's firm decision to prioritize their well-being over rekindling a relationship that once caused them harm.

The song also touches on themes of regret and realization. The partner's return is driven by the realization that the emotional void left by the protagonist cannot be filled by anyone else. The protagonist acknowledges this but stands their ground, recognizing that the partner's actions were a result of playing with emotions and ultimately failing. The song ends on a note of triumph for the protagonist, who, despite the pain, emerges victorious by choosing self-respect and moving forward.
